#2f09d0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2f09d0 is composed of 18.4% red, 3.5% green and 81.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 77.4% cyan, 95.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 18.4% black. It has a hue angle of 251.5 degrees, a saturation of 91.7% and a lightness of 42.5%. #2f09d0 color hex could be obtained by blending #5e12ff with #0000a1. Closest websafe color is: #3300cc.

#2f09d0 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2f09d0 has RGB values of R:47, G:9, B:208 and CMYK values of C:0.77, M:0.96, Y:0,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 3082704.
